Catania - It is more than 3350 meters high, making it the highest active volcano in Europe: Mount Etna.

So far this year he has been very active.

Since mid-February it broke out regularly and sometimes spectacularly.

So again now.

At the volcano on the Italian island of Sicily, increased activity was measured in the early morning hours.

The national institute for geophysics and volcanology announced on Saturday (October 23).

Etna in Sicily spits ash and lava: a column of smoke rises far into the sky

Photos showed lava and ash seeping out of the crater on the south-east side of the volcano.

The gray column of smoke rose from Mount Etna far into the sky.

However, there were initially no reports of major damage.

However, there have been reports of ash raining down in places.

For the people around the erupting volcano, the raining ash is often a major problem.

The airport in the city of Catania at the foot of Mount Etna had to temporarily shut down in the past because the runway was dirty.

In September, the Sicilian government pledged two million euros in aid to the municipalities for the ash damage.

Etna in Sicily spits ash and lava: “nightmare” for farmers

Farmers on the Italian island are particularly hard hit by the aftermath of the ash rain.

The Coldiretti Agricultural Association spoke on Saturday that the "nightmare" was returning to the Sicilian fields.

The ashes cause damage to the cultivated areas.

Standards are needed to protect farmers.

The cleaning of the fields takes time, water and thus massive labor input at enormously high, unacceptable costs.
